Don't fall into BJP trap, Prakash Raj advises Pawan

Senior actor Prakash Raj is well known for his staunch opposition to the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) and the saffron brigade.

He has frequently faced severe backlash from Sangh activists for his outspoken criticism of the Narendra Modi government.

His anti-BJP stance has also led to a rift with fellow actors, including Power Star and Jana Sena Party president Pawan Kalyan, who is currently the deputy chief minister of Andhra Pradesh.

Ever since Pawan Kalyan aligned himself with the BJP and adopted a Hindutva-leaning political stance, Prakash Raj has consistently criticized him in social media posts and interviews.

He openly disagreed with Pawan Kalyan's “prayaschitta deeksha” during the Tirumala laddu adulteration controversy, his advocacy for Sanatana Dharma, and his views on the Hindi imposition debate.

In an interview on Monday, Prakash Raj warned Pawan Kalyan against getting trapped by the BJP.

He questioned why the deputy chief minister was so concerned about the BJP’s affairs in Maharashtra, Tamil Nadu, or West Bengal.

“First, focus on your own constituency. There are enough issues that need your attention there. Why worry about what’s happening in Maharashtra or Tamil Nadu or West Bengal?” he asked.

Calling the BJP a dangerous party, Prakash Raj said, “If BJP leaders place a hand on your shoulder, it’s not out of affection — it’s because they have an agenda. Once that agenda is fulfilled, they’ll discard you like a hot potato.”
